Pin Test: Back to School Snacks

August 24, 2012 · Delia 5 Comments

Today’s Pin Test is one of those pins that makes you go…, “Well duh, why didn’t I think of that?” The idea is SO simple, yet it’s a great idea I wasn’t implementing.

It’s a snack basket with portioned out serving sized snacks for your kids. See the pin here.

I stopped into my local Dollar Tree and found this cute, cute blue wire basket. It’s a bit smaller than I wanted for my snack basket but I just couldn’t leave the store without it. When I got home I realized it was the perfect size for a our limited pantry space anyway. So it worked out quite nice. 馃檪

The boys love it so far, especially Reid who usually has to ask for help to get what he wants. It’s at his level and easy for him to access; which in turn helps me.
